use std::fmt;
use crate::{config::WIKIDATA_CONFIG, Config, RestApiError};
#[derive(Debug, Clone, Default, PartialEq)]
pub enum EntityId {
#[default]
None,
Item(String),
Property(String),
}
impl EntityId {
pub const fn id(&self) -> Result<&String, RestApiError> {
match self {
EntityId::None => Err(RestApiError::IsNone),
EntityId::Item(id) => Ok(id),
EntityId::Property(id) => Ok(id),
}
}
pub const fn group(&self) -> Result<&str, RestApiError> {
match self {
EntityId::Item(_) => Ok("items"),
EntityId::Property(_) => Ok("properties"),
_ => Err(RestApiError::IsNone),
}
}
pub const fn entity_type(&self) -> Result<&str, RestApiError> {
match self {
EntityId::Item(_) => Ok("item"),
EntityId::Property(_) => Ok("property"),
_ => Err(RestApiError::IsNone),
}
}
pub fn new<S: Into<String>>(id: S) -> Result<EntityId, RestApiError> {
Self::new_from_config(id, &WIKIDATA_CONFIG)
}
pub fn new_from_config<S: Into<String>>(
id: S,
config: &Config,
) -> Result<EntityId, RestApiError> {
let id = id.into();
if id.starts_with(config.item_letter()) {
Ok(EntityId::Item(id))
} else if id.starts_with(config.property_letter()) {
Ok(EntityId::Property(id))
} else {
Err(RestApiError::UnknownEntityLetter(id))
}
}
pub const fn none() -> EntityId {
EntityId::None
}
pub fn item<S: Into<String>>(s: S) -> EntityId {
EntityId::Item(s.into())
}
pub fn property(s: &str) -> EntityId {
EntityId::Property(s.to_string())
}
pub fn is_some(&self) -> bool {
*self != EntityId::None
}
pub fn is_none(&self) -> bool {
*self == EntityId::None
}
}
impl From<EntityId> for String {
fn from(val: EntityId) -> Self {
match val {
EntityId::Item(id) | EntityId::Property(id) => id,
EntityId::None => String::new(),
}
}
}
impl fmt::Display for EntityId {
fn fmt(&self, f: &mut fmt::Formatter<'_>) -> fmt::Result {
match self {
EntityId::Item(id) => write!(f, "{id}"),
EntityId::Property(id) => write!(f, "{id}"),
EntityId::None => Err(fmt::Error),
}
}
}
